Summary
MOVIETONE CARD TITLE: Cooling Off. DESCRIPTION: Keeping cool in a heat wave - here’s how Berliners treated a temperature of a hundred degrees, the hottest since 1830. Kids in bathing dress, gentlemen in evening dress, trying to keep cool! SHOTLIST: TS people bathing. GV swimming pool. Same chute, closer same children down chute, closer kid into water. CU baby with toy duck. LS penguin. TS people sunbathing. MS fat women. FS fat gentleman. CU walrus.
